To understand romance in Iranian cinema, one must understand the unique constraints under which filmmakers operate. Following the 1979 Islamic Revolution, strict codes of modesty were instituted for the screen. On-screen physical contact between unrelated men and women—including holding hands or kissing—is strictly prohibited. Women must wear the hijab, even in private domestic settings on film.

Navigating strict domestic censorship laws, Iranian filmmakers developed a highly nuanced visual and narrative language to portray love. By replacing physical intimacy with poetic symbolism, intense glances, and complex moral dilemmas, Iranian cinema offers some of the most profound, emotionally resonant romantic storylines in world history. Directed by Safi Yazdanian, this contemporary romantic drama is a love letter to memory and nostalgia. Goli returns to her hometown of Rasht after twenty years in France. Upon arrival, she is greeted by Farhad, a frame maker who claims to know her intimately, though she has no recollection of him. The film beautifully weaves together the past and present, exploring the lingering impact of unrequited love and the subjective nature of shared romantic histories. 5.
